2. Indenture dated 21 Sept. 1670, between Benj. Whichcott, D.D. and the Master and Fellows of Emanuel College, Cambridge, respecting lands in St. Giles's in the Fields. fo. 18.
60. Richard Bishop of London to the Vicechancellor and Heads of the University of Cambridge, respecting the new translation of the Bible; together with a list of the persons employed, and a copy of the rules to be observed in the translation. Fulham, 31 July 1604. fo. 284.
70. Mr. Baker to the Bishop of Peterborough, communicating copies of two Letters of Archbishop Bancroft, one in Latin the other in English. Cambr. April 2, 1723. fo. 309 b.
